Abstract

A process for establishing a session between a first node and a second node of a communications network, the process including receiving a first request addressed from the first node and addressed to the second node; sending, in response to receipt of the first request, a response addressed to the first node to cause the first node to send a second request addressed to the second node, the response including first validation data; receiving the second request sent by the first node, the second request including second validation data; and determining, on the basis of the second validation data, whether to establish the session.

1 . A process for establishing a session between a first node and a second node of a communications network, the process including:
 receiving a first request to initiate a session between said first node and said second node, said first request being addressed from said first node and addressed to said second node and being encapsulated with a connectionless transport layer protocol;   sending, in response to receipt of said first request, a response addressed to said first node to cause said first node to send a second request to initiate a session between said first node and said second node, said second request being addressed to said second node, said response including first validation data;   receiving said second request sent by said first node, said second request including second validation data; and   determining, on the basis of said second validation data, whether to establish said session.   
     
     
         2 . A process for establishing a SIP session between a first node and a second node of a communications network, the process including:
 receiving a first SIP  INVITE  request addressed from said first node and addressed to said second node;   sending, in response to receipt of said first SIP  INVITE  request, a SIP REDIRECT response addressed to said first node to cause said first node to send a second SIP INVITE request addressed to said second node, said SIP REDIRECT response including first validation data;   receiving said second SIP  INVITE  request sent by said first node, said second SIP  INVITE  request including second validation data; and   determining, on the basis of said second validation data, whether to establish said session.   
     
     
         3 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said determining includes determining whether to establish said session on the basis of a comparison of said first validation data and said second validation data. 
     
     
         4 . The process of  claim 1 , including processing said first request to generate said first validation data. 
     
     
         5 . The process of  claim 4 , wherein said first validation data is generated from at least one of an address of said first node and an address of said second node. 
     
     
         6 . The process of  claim 4 , wherein said validation data is based on a time of receipt of said first request. 
     
     
         7 . The process of  claim 4 , wherein said processing includes applying a hash function to one or more header fields of said first request. 
     
     
         8 . The process of  claim 4 , wherein said processing includes applying a hash function to a timestamp. 
     
     
         9 . The process of any one of  claim 1 , wherein said first validation data includes a cryptographic signature. 
     
     
         10 . The process of any one of  claim 1 , wherein said first request includes a TO header field including an address of said first node, and said response includes a header field including said address of said first node and said first validation data.

The process of any one of  claim 1 , wherein said step of determining includes generating third validation data from one or more header fields of said second request, and determining whether to establish said session on the basis of a comparison of said third validation data with validation data generated from one or more corresponding header fields of said first request. 
     
     
         12 . The process of  claim 11 , wherein said step of determining includes establishing said session only if the first validation data generated for the first request is the same as the third validation data generated from the second request. 
     
     
         13 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said step of determining includes forwarding said second request to said second node only if the validation data generated for the first request is the same as the validation data generated from the second request. 
     
     
         14 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ein said first request is encapsulated using a connectionless transport layer protocol. 
     
     
         15 . The process of  claim 14 , wherein said first request is encapsulated in a UDP packet. 
     
     
         16 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ein the process is executed by a third node of said communications network. 
     
     
         17 . The process of  claim 16 , wherein said communications network is configured so that all packets sent to said second node are received by said third node for forwarding to said second node. 
     
     
         18 . A system or device having one or more components for executing the steps of  claim 1 . 
     
     
         19 . A proxy server having one or more components for executing the steps of  claim 1 . 
     
     
         20 . A VoIP telephone having one or more components for executing the steps of  claim 1 . 
     
     
         21 . A computer-readable storage medium having stored thereon program code for executing the steps of  claim 1 . 
     
     
         22 . A node of a communications network, the node being adapted to:
 receive a first request addressed from said first node and addressed to said second node, said first request being encapsulated with a connectionless transport layer protocol;   send a response addressed to said first node to cause said first node to send a second request addressed to said second node, said response including first validation data;   receive said second request sent by said first node, said second request including second validation data; and   determine, on the basis of said second validation data, whether to establish said session.   
     
     
         23 . The node of  claim 22 , wherein said requests are SIP INVITE messages and said response is a SIP REDIRECT message. 
     
     
         24 . The node of  claim 22 , wherein said node is adapted to generate said first validation data from said first request. 
     
     
         25 . The node of  claim 22 , wherein said node is adapted to determine whether to establish said session on the basis of a comparison of said first validation data and said second validation data.
